  • Publication number: 20240065600
    Abstract: An emotion estimating device, an emotion estimating system, and an emotion estimating method capable of estimating an emotion of a subject based on information obtained from daily activities can be provided. An emotion estimating device includes an interface that receives input of walking data of a subject measured by a measurement device and emotion data obtained by quantifying the emotion of the subject, a storage that stores the walking data and the emotion data, and an computer that obtains corresponding data in which a plurality of walking parameters included in the walking data stored in the storage are associated with the emotion data. When the interface newly receives the input of the walking data, the computer estimates the emotion of the subject from the plurality of walking parameters included in the newly received walking data, and outputs information indicating the estimated emotion of the subject.

  • Publication number: 20240049989
    Abstract: In a gait evaluation system, qualitative measurement value acquirers acquire at least measurement values of a stride length and a cadence as qualitative parameters indicating a walking form, measured by a measurement device worn by a subject. A qualitative result determination unit determines an evaluation result regarding a walking form using, as a certain evaluation model, an evaluation formula set such that a weight is added at least to the measurement value of the stride length. The measurement value of the stride length is a ratio of an average stride length to the height of the subject measured.

  • Publication number: 20230157606
    Abstract: In a physical strength evaluation system, a reference storage stores a walking heart rate reference in which a correspondence relationship of a standard value of a relative heart rate with respect to a walking speed is defined for every gender and every age, a speed acquisition unit acquires a measured value of a walking speed of a subject, a heart rate acquisition unit acquires a measured value of the relative heart rate of the subject. A standard value derivation unit derives the standard value of the relative heart rate corresponding to the measured value of the walking speed that has been acquired, based on the walking heart rate reference. A level determination unit determines an evaluation value of a physical strength level of the subject, based on a difference between the measured value of the relative heart rate and the standard value of the relative heart rate.

  • Patent number: 11647814
    Abstract: In a markerless foot size estimation device 100, a shape data input unit 10 acquires three-dimensional shape data of a foot of a subject and stores the three-dimensional shape data in a shape data storage unit 20. A characteristic extraction unit 30 extracts foot shape characteristics from the three-dimensional shape data of a subject's foot stored in the shape data storage unit 20, and stores the foot shape characteristics in a shape characteristic storage unit 40. A machine learning unit 50 uses, as teacher data, foot shape characteristics and arch height stored in the shape characteristic storage unit 40 to create, through machine learning, an estimation model used to estimate arch height based on foot shape characteristics, and stores the estimation model in an estimation model storage unit 60. An estimation output unit 70 uses the estimation model stored in the estimation model storage unit 60 to estimate arch height based on extracted shape characteristics and outputs the arch height.

  • Patent number: 9180438
    Abstract: A wire catalyst for hydrogenation reaction and/or dehydrogenation reaction comprises a metallic core and an oxide surface layer covering at least part of the surface thereof. The metallic core is electrically conductive so that the metallic core itself can generate heat by directly passing an electric current therethrough or electromagnetic induction. The oxide surface layer is made of an oxide of a metallic element constituting the metallic core. The oxide surface layer is provided with a porous structure having pores opening at the surface of the oxide surface layer. The catalytic material is supported in the pores of the oxide surface layer. When a shaped wire catalyst is manufactured, the shaping into a specific shape is made before the oxide surface layer having the porous structure is formed and the catalytic material is supported thereon.

  • Patent number: 8927781
    Abstract: A method for producing ethanol by which ethanol can be synthesized from less fermentable biomass materials such as plant-derived materials and rice straws and industrial waste biomass materials such as wooden building materials and pulp and which can therefore broaden the range of raw materials for the production of ethanol. Specifically, a method for producing ethanol including reacting a raw material gas obtained by a thermochemical gasification reaction of biomass in the presence of a catalyst containing rhodium, at least one transition metal, and at least one element selected from lithium, magnesium and zinc.
